Job Description

We are looking for a Senior Back-End Developer with strong Java expertise to join our engineering team and play a key role in designing, building, and scaling our enterprise back-end systems.

You will architect and deliver high-performance APIs and data-intensive services that power our applications, working within a modern cloud-native stack built on GCP.

You'll work across multiple Java versions, with a strong preference for Java 21, leveraging modern language features such as Virtual Threads (Project Loom), Sequenced Collections, Record Patterns, and Pattern Matching.

You will collaborate closely with front-end engineers, data engineers, and product teams to deliver robust, secure, and maintainable solutions in a fast-paced Agile environment.

EPAM NEORIS is a digital accelerator that supports some of the world’s leading companies in addressing business challenges and advancing their technology evolution, combining global engineering excellence with regional expertise and local proximity.
With operations across 11 countries in Ibero-America and more than 4,000 professionals in the region, we foster a diverse and inclusive culture focused on collaboration, continuous learning, and innovation.
As part of EPAM, a global network of more than 60,000 professionals across 55+ countries, we help organizations scale, modernize, and accelerate their digital capabilities through Cloud, Data & Analytics, Artificial Intelligence, Cybersecurity, Intelligent Automation, Strategic Consulting, and Software Engineering.
